Description

Experience lakeside living at its finest in this stunning 2-bed 2-bath condo boasting soaring 10-foot ceilings and an open-concept design. The kitchen features granite countertops, a stylish backsplash, and stainless steel appliances, seamlessly flowing into the living area. Step outside to your private patio—complete with a cozy fireplace—and take in the breathtaking views of Tempe Town Lake. At North Shore, every day feels like a getaway. Enjoy secure fob access, 24/7 security, a state-of-the-art fitness center, and a resort-style pool and spa overlooking the lake. Perfectly situated, you're just steps from Mill Avenue, ASU, the light rail, with Old Town Scottsdale and Phoenix Sky Harbor Airport only minutes away.
